Caprylic/ Capric Triglyceride Skin Benefits: Moisturizing Product Spreadability

Caprylic /capric triglyceride is derived from coconut oil and glycerin. Chemically, caprylic /capric triglyceride contains a high concentration of fatty acids, which allows it to provide an occlusive layer to help increase moisture-retention at the skins surface. As a result, caprylic /capric triglyceride can have emollient properties that may boost skin-hydration levels. 12

Caprylic /capric triglyceride may also work as a slip agent for cosmetic formulas. It is often paired with dimethicone PEG/PPG in order to produce a desirable emulsifying formula, which gives cosmetic products a more spreadable, silky texture. Caprylic/capric triglyceride is most often implemented into eyeliner products, facial moisturizers, serums, and sunscreens. 3

    Are Caprylic/capric Triglycerides Safe

    The US Food and Drug Administrationincludes caprylic acid on its list of substances considered Generally Recognized As Safe as a food additive.

    The Cosmetic Ingredient Review Expert Panel, a group that is responsible for evaluating the safety of skincare and cosmetic ingredients, has reviewed the safety of caprylic/capric triglycerides. This ingredient did not demonstrate any potential for skin/eye irritation or sensitization.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ride is known to be compatible with most skin types, making it an excellent choice for use in products for sensitive skin.

    How Is Caprylic Triglyceride Made

    CAPRYLIC / CAPRIC TRIGLYCERIDE Natural Carrier Oil  Buy Makeup ...

    Caprylic/Capric Triglycerides are naturally found in very small amounts in coconut oil. For commercial use, Caprylic Triglyceride needs to be in pure form. For achieving the pure form of Caprylic Triglyceride, the oils are split and the specific fatty acids are isolated which are then combined with glycerine to form pure Caprylic Triglyceride which is further purified using clay and applying intense heat and steam. The Caprylic Triglyceride thus obtained is used in many skincare and cosmetic products.

    Acts As A Dispersing Agent

    Dispersing agents are those chemical compounds which help to stabilize the ingredients by binding it together. Adding active ingredients, pigments or scents in a good dispersing agent helps prevent the ingredients from clumping or sinking to the bottom of the formulation. Due to the thick and viscous texture of Caprylic Triglyceride, it is used as a dispersing agent in many perfumes, deodorants etc. It also enhances the absorption of active ingredients in the formulation into the skin and makes your skincare products spread easily on the surface of the skin making it soft and supple.

    Is Caprylic/capric Triglyceride Natural

    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ride is created through a number of complicated chemical reactions and fractionated coconut oil is created through the simple physical process of heating and cooling down.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ride is a much more refined oil than fractionated coconut oil and with refinement comes loss of therapeutic properties. Especially through high heat processes like steam hydrolysis, thats why everybody shouts about how good their COLD pressed oils are!

    For the skincare industry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ride is used to replicate the absorbency of oils like camellia, rosehip, macadamia or hazelnut and to create a silky smooth feel.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ride has a much higher shelf life than most other oils, especially the lighter oils used in serums and is available at a lower price. So its great for saving money and increasing profit margins on a product while still benefiting from some really useful properties. But, in our opinion its not the real deal and not really a natural oil.

    How Capric Caprylic Triglyceride Is Made

    Caprylic triglyceride is the mixed triester of glycerin and caprylic and capric acids. It is made by first separating the fatty acids and the glycerol in coconut oil. This is done by hydrolyzing the coconut oil, which involves applying heat and pressure to the oil to split it apart. The acids then go through esterification to add back the glycerol. The resulting oil is called capric or caprylic triglyceride. It has different properties from raw coconut oil.

    In Vitro Direct Goat Activity Assays Using Microsomes

    CAPRYLIC / CAPRIC TRIGLYCERIDE Natural Carrier Oil  Buy Makeup ...

    Yang et al. established an in vitro GOAT acyl transfer assay using membranes enriched for ER from insect cells infected with baculovirus encoding mouse GOAT to transfer 3H-labeled octanoate onto proghrelin-His8 . Mouse GOAT microsomes were prepared as follows: GOAT was cloned into pFastBac HT-A, giving it an N-terminal His10-TEV tag, and the baculovirus infected SF9 cells from which the microsomes were harvested. As a negative control, the MBOAT fingerprint residue H338 was mutated to alanine and control virus was also employed. Proghrelin-His8 and mutant proghrelins were produced in bacteria using an N-terminal GST-TEV tag, such that TEV cleavage produced the authentic N-terminal sequence of proghrelin.

    The in vitro octanoylation assay of Yang et al. was performed using 1 M3H-octanoyl-CoA , 5 g proghrelin-His8 , and 50 g GOAT-containing microsomes. Reactions were quenched with buffer containing 0.1% SDS, labeled proghrelin was separated from the reaction mixture using nickel-affinity chromatography, and 3H-octanoyl-proghrelin was quantified using liquid scintillation counting. Yang et al. found that addition of long-chain fatty coenzyme A conjugates stimulate the reaction up to 3.5-fold by preventing hydrolysis of octanoyl-CoA to octanoate and therefore 50 M palmitoyl-CoA was present in all further reactions.

    Risks And Side Effects

    Differin Skincare Restorative Night Facial Moisturizer Review and How to Use

    Experts generally recognize caprylic triglyceride as being safe.

    For instance, the Food and Drug Administration note that small amounts of caprylic acid are usually safe at certain levels in food products.

    A report from the CIR also highlights several studies investigating the effects of caprylic triglyceride on the skin. The research shows that reactions to this compound are generally uncommon or mild, even at high doses.

    However, some people should avoid these products, including those who have an allergy to coconut oil. It may still be possible to experience a reaction with purified ingredients.

    Testing the product on a small patch of skin with the product first is a good way to check for a reaction.

    People with environmental concerns may also wish to avoid caprylic triglyceride, as research shows that the farming of both palm and coconut oil is harmful to the environment.

    What Are The Benefits Of Caprylic/capric Triglycerides

    Caprylic/capric triglycerides are primarily used to improve the texture of formulations. However, they do have added benefits to the skin. While these benefits dont constitute the use of caprylic/capric triglycerides as a key ingredient, it can help to support other key ingredients.

    EmollientEmollients work to soften the skin by trapping moisture in the top layers of the skin. Emollients, like caprylic/capric triglycerides, form a protective barrier on the surface of the skin which prevents water loss to the environment. This is especially beneficial for skin that is dry, flaky or has had some disruption to the skins natural barrier.

    Dispersing agentAs a dispersing agent, caprylic/capric triglycerides help to enhance the delivery of other key ingredients so that they can be fully absorbed by the skin.

    TextureThe oily texture of caprylic/capric triglycerides helps to thicken cosmetic formulations and provides a slipperiness. In turn, products that contain caprylic/capric triglycerides will be easy to spread and also create a smooth feeling on the skin.

    AntioxidantAccording to Healthline caprylic acid is an antioxidant. Antioxidants help to neutralize free radicals that are produced during oxidation. Oxidation is a natural process in the body that can be increased by exposure to environmental factors such as smoking, the sun, and diet. Free radicals have been linked with the aging process.
